About The Position

Determined to end Veteran suicide, K9s For Warriors is the leading nonprofit organization providing Service Dogs to military Veterans nationwide suffering from PTSD, traumatic brain injury, and/or military sexual trauma — at no financial cost to the Veteran. Founded in 2011 as a 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ization, K9s For Warriors is committed to saving lives at both ends of the leash by primarily rescuing dogs and pairing them with Veterans in need. In order to continue the great work we’re doing, we’re looking to add a Veterinary Technician to our amazing team! Role and Responsibilities Under the general direction and supervision of Medical Management, the Veterinary Technician is responsible for the medical care and wellness of all dogs within the program and the maintenance of all medical records.

Responsibilities

  • Review medical records and establish a plan of action for each dog upon intake to the program
  • Administer vaccines under Veterinarian supervision/direction
  • Collect and run diagnostic samples including but not limited to fecal, blood, urine, and skin. Submit to outside laboratories when needed.
  • Implant microchips as needed and/or transfer ownership of implanted microchips. Maintain current microchip information.
  • Create individualized dietary plans for all dogs in the program. Adjust diets with current weight trends. Maintain weight and food intake logs.
  • Communicate with local veterinary clinics to schedule necessary appointments for all dogs in the program. Transport dogs as needed.
  • Assist doctors with exams and in surgery
  • Intubate and administer anesthetic drugs and monitor anesthesia
  • Obtain vitals, perform simple medical exams, and complete medical notes under Veterinarian supervision/direction
  • Maintain current and comprehensive medical records, including applicable certificates, on all dogs in the program
  • Maintain current inventory and logs of medications, clinic supplies, diagnostic supplies, etc.
  • Obtain health certificates and applicable documents for local and interstate transport, including but not limited to Puerto Rico, Hawaii, and Guam.
  • Fill and administer intravenous, intramuscular, subcutaneous, topical, and oral drugs/medications, including monthly preventions
  • Always handle animals humanely and safely
  • Follow and adhere to all PPE policies
  • Participate in mock veterinary exams with Warriors during class, educating about appropriate veterinary care and what to expect when returning home with their Service Dog
  • Ability to work with dogs on unknown or outdated vaccination history
  • Initiate emergency procedures when indicated
  • Follow medical care guidelines provided by Veterinarian
  • Report any abnormalities with dogs to the Medical Management and Veterinarian
  • Address any medical concerns our Warriors may have regarding their Service Dog, and conduct exams, draft care plans, and conduct follow ups, as needed.
